English-Chinese translation for "to enunciate"
"to enunciate" Chinese translation
to enunciate {verb}
to enunciate [enunciated|enunciated] {vb} (also: to clarify, to unfold, to illuminate, to illustrate)
to enunciate [enunciated|enunciated] {vb} (also: to pronounce, pronounce)
to enunciate
Synonyms
Synonyms (English) for "enunciate":
© Princeton Universityarticulate · vocalize · vocalise · pronounce · enounce · sound out · say
Similar words
entrepot · entrepreneur · entrepreneurial · entrepreneurship · entries · entropy · entrust · entry · entryway · enumerator · enunciate · envelope · envelopes · enviable · envious · environment · environment-friendly · environmental · environmentalism · environmentalist · environmentology
Moreover bab.la provides the English-Swedish dictionary for more translations.